NVIDIA研究人员开发了一种新的纹理压缩算法——神经纹理压缩(NTC),可提供更高的分辨率和更低的显存占用。
NTC算法将纹理视为一个三维张量,并对多个通道、Mipmaps一起进行压缩,不需要特定硬件,而是以矩阵乘法的方式在任何现代GPU上获得加速。
相比于传统的GPU纹理压缩算法BC,NTC算法分辨率提升4倍,纹理规模扩大了16倍,质量更高。使用RTX 4090压缩9个通道、4K分辨率的纹理,BC算法体积3.33MB,NTC算法为3.6MB,但渲染时间只从0.49ms增加到1.15ms。这一技术能够显著优化游戏系统资源消耗,为未来的游戏技术发展注入新的动力。
(8173284)